The practice of establishing an isolated replica of the production data warehouse within a data build tool (dbt) project allows for safe testing and validation of code changes before deploying to the live environment. This isolated replica, often termed a development or testing zone, mirrors the structure and data of the primary system but operates independently. An example includes configuring distinct database schemas or cloud-based data warehouse instances where transformations can be executed without impacting production datasets or analytical workflows.

Establishing a dedicated area for testing brings significant advantages. It mitigates the risk of introducing errors into the live data, prevents disruption of ongoing analyses, and allows for experimentation with new data models and transformations in a controlled setting. Historically, the absence of such mechanisms led to data quality issues and reporting inaccuracies, causing business disruption and eroding trust in data-driven insights. The ability to validate changes thoroughly before release improves data governance and promotes confidence in the reliability of the data pipeline.

Sculptra is an injectable poly-L-lactic acid (PLLA) collagen stimulator. Its primary function is to gradually restore facial volume loss associated with aging. The treatment involves a series of injections administered over several months. It doesn’t provide immediate results in the manner of dermal fillers that add volume directly.

The appeal of this treatment lies in its natural-looking and long-lasting effects. By stimulating the body’s own collagen production, it offers a subtle and gradual improvement in facial contours. This approach avoids the sudden, sometimes artificial, appearance that can be associated with other cosmetic procedures. The results are typically more durable, often lasting for two years or longer, compared to hyaluronic acid-based fillers. The longevity stems from the fundamental collagen regeneration process, rather than the immediate addition of a filling substance.
